Effective Pandas 2
Pandas 2 mastery without the academic fluff
Free with Audible trial. Cancel anytime.
Quick Facts
| Author | Matt Harrison |
| Narrator | Virtual Voice |
| Runtime | 22h00m |
| Published | January 8, 2025 |
| Rating | Not yet rated |
| Categories | Computers & Technology, Data Science, Programming & Software Development |
| Format | Audiobook (Digital) |
| Platform | Audible |
About This Audiobook
*Effective Pandas 2* isn’t another dry reference manual—it’s the rare technical book that *teaches* rather than just documents. Matt Harrison strips away Pandas’ infamous learning curve by focusing on the 20% of features that solve 80% of real-world data problems. Unlike most programming books that drown you in edge cases, this one prioritizes *practical patterns*: how to reshape messy data with minimal code, when to use `polars` as a turbocharged alternative, and why Pandas 2’s new `copy-on-write` behavior will either save your bacon or break your legacy scripts.
The Virtual Voice narration is a gamble that pays off—its measured, code-friendly cadence avoids the robotic pitfalls of many synth narrators, though purists may miss human inflection for emphasis. What sets this audiobook apart is its *ruthless efficiency*: chapters are structured as self-contained "recipes," so you can jump straight to solving a `groupby` nightmare or optimizing a memory-hogging DataFrame without wading through theory. The production even includes subtle audio cues (a faint *click*) to mark code block transitions—a small but brilliant touch for listeners toggling between driving and coding."
"review": "I’ll admit I was skeptical about a 22-hour audiobook on a data library—until I realized *Effective Pandas 2* is less a lecture and more a *debugging session with a patient mentor*. Harrison’s writing shines in audio because he anticipates frustration. When explaining `merge` operations, he doesn’t just list parameters; he walks through the *mental model* of how Pandas aligns keys, then immediately contrasts it with SQL joins. That’s the kind of clarity missing from Stack Overflow threads. The Virtual Voice narrator handles code snippets surprisingly well, pausing just long enough after `df.loc[...]` to let you visualize the operation, though I occasionally wished for more vocal variety during conceptual deep dives (the chapter on time series felt monotonous by hour 18).
The book’s biggest strength—and occasional weakness—is its *opinionated pragmatism*. Harrison doesn’t shy from calling out Pandas’ warts (e.g., "If you’re using `iterrows`, you’re probably doing it wrong") and offers `polars` or `duckdb` alternatives where they’re objectively faster. This candor is refreshing, but purists might bristle at his dismissal of certain "academic" use cases. Production-wise, the audio quality is crisp, though the lack of a PDF companion for complex DataFrame outputs means you’ll want to pause frequently to experiment in a notebook. Still, for anyone who’s ever stared at a `SettingWithCopyWarning` in despair, this audiobook is the closest thing to a Pandas therapist—just bring your headphones and a REPL.
Why Listen to Effective Pandas 2?
- Expert narration by Virtual Voice brings every character and scene to life across 22h00m of immersive audio.
- Free with your Audible trial — keep the audiobook forever even if you cancel.
- Perfect for commutes, workouts, and relaxation. Listen anywhere, anytime.
Editor's Review
AudioBook Atlas
Download: Effective Pandas 2
Some links on this page are affiliate links. If you make a purchase through one of them, we may earn a small commission at no extra cost to you.
Effective Pandas 2 by Matt Harrison is an immersive listening experience. Performed by Virtual Voice with a runtime of 22h00m, you can start with a free trial that you can cancel at any time. The audiobook remains yours forever, even if you end the trial.